FACTS ABOUT

Sri Lanka

Sri Lanka State Symbol

Sri Lanka is an island located in the Indian Ocean. It administers the island from both its commercial capital of Colombo and the administrative capital of Sri Jayewardenepura, Kotte. Sri Lanka is a semi-presidential representative democratic republic, whereby the President of Sri Lanka is both head of state and head of government, and it relies on a multi-party system. Executive power is exercised by the President on the advice of the Prime Minister and the Cabinet of Ministers. It also consists of an opposition and other political parties which make up the opposition

Capital 

Sri Jayewardenepura Kotte (legislative)[1]

Colombo (executive and judicial)

Largest city        

Colombo

Official languages           

Sinhala

Tamil

Recognised languages  

English

Ethnic groups (2012[4])

74.9% Sinhalese

11.2% Sri Lankan Tamils

9.2% Sri Lankan Moors

4.2% Indian Tamils

0.5% Others (incl. Burghers, Malays, Veddhas, Chinese, Indians)

Religion (2012)

70.2% Buddhism (official)[5]

12.6% Hinduism

9.7% Islam

7.4% Christianity

0.1% Other/None

Demonym(s)     Sri Lankan

Government Unitary semi-presidential republic

President

Ranil Wickremesinghe

Prime Minister

Dinesh Gunawardena

Speaker of the Parliament

Mahinda Yapa Abeywardena

Chief Justice

Jayantha Jayasuriya
